editNoun
editMünstertaler m (strong, genitive Münstertalers, plural Münstertaler, feminine Münstertalerin)
- A native or resident of Val Müstair.
- A native or resident of Münstertal.

Usage notes
edit- Words like this are considered indeclinable adjectives, as noted by Duden, DWDS and other modern German references, but are capitalized because they originated as genitive plurals of substantives. See -er for more.
